Bayan Lepas is a suburb of George Town in the Malaysian state of Penang.Located near the southeastern tip of Penang Island, 15 km (9.3 mi) south of the city centre, it is home to the Penang International Airport, the third busiest airport in Malaysia, as well as one of the oldest free industrial zones in the country.

Bayan Lepas is a state constituency in Penang, Malaysia, that has been represented in the Penang State Legislative Assembly since 1959. It covers the southwestern corner of Penang Island , including the old quarter of the town of Bayan Lepas and fishing villages along the island's southern coast.

The Northeast District is a district in George Town within the Malaysian state of Penang.The district covers the northeastern half of Penang Island, including downtown George Town, and borders the Southwest District.
The South Seberang Perai District is a district in Seberang Perai within the Malaysian state of Penang.The district covers the southern third of Seberang Perai. It borders Central Seberang Perai to the north, Kedah to the east and Perak to the south.
Bayan Baru is a neighbourhood of George Town in the Malaysian state of Penang. [3] Located 11 km (6.8 mi) south of the city centre, it lies within the suburb of Bayan Lepas, and adjacent to the Bayan Lepas Free Industrial Zone, Relau, Sungai Ara and Bukit Jambul. The township was created in the 1970s following the establishment of the zone.
